Version | Text |
Hebrew | וזאת ליהודה ויאמר שמע יהוה קול יהודה ואל־עמו תביאנו ידיו רב לו ועזר מצריו תהיה׃ ס |
Greek | και αυτη ιουδα εισακουσον κυριε φωνης ιουδα και εις τον λαον αυτου εισελθοισαν αι χειρες αυτου διακρινουσιν αυτω και βοηθος εκ των εχθρων αυτου |
Latin | Hæc est Judæ benedicio : Audi, Domine, vocem Judæ, et ad populum suum introduc eum : manus ejus pugnabunt pro eo, et adjutor illius contra adversarios ejus erit. |
KJV | And this is the blessing of Judah: and he said, Hear, LORD, the voice of Judah, and bring him unto his people: let his hands be sufficient for him; and be thou an help to him from his enemies. |
WEB | This is [the blessing] of Judah: and he said, "Hear, Yahweh, the voice of Judah. Bring him in to his people. With his hands he contended for himself. You shall be a help against his adversaries." |
